Key Duties & Responsibilities   

  • Administer and support production and non-production database environments, including SQL Server, PostgreSQL, MySQL, and AWS-managed database services. 
  • Monitor database health, availability, capacity, and performance to identify issues before they impact clients or internal users. 
  • Troubleshoot and resolve database performance issues, including slow queries, blocking, resource contention, indexing problems, and inefficient application data access patterns. 
  • Design, implement, and maintain backup, restore, high availability, and disaster recovery processes for mission-critical databases. 
  • Regularly test recovery procedures to ensure databases can be restored within required business recovery objectives. 
  • Maintain database security best practices, including access control, permissions, encryption, auditability, and compliance with internal data protection policies. 
  • Support database patching, upgrades, maintenance windows, and lifecycle management with minimal disruption to business operations. 
  • Partner with application engineering teams to review database design, improve query performance, optimize schemas, and ensure applications use databases efficiently. 
  • Establish and maintain database operational standards, documentation, runbooks, monitoring dashboards, and incident response procedures. 
  • Support cloud database operations in AWS, including RDS, Aurora, EC2-hosted databases, parameter/configuration management, storage planning, replication, and scaling. 
  • Assist with database migration and modernization efforts, including schema conversion, data movement, validation, performance testing, and production cutover planning. 
  • Recommend and implement tools, automation, and process improvements that increase database reliability, observability, performance, and operational efficiency. 

Desired Experience & Qualifications 

  • 7+ years of hands-on DBA experience supporting business-critical production databases. 
  • Strong expertise with Microsoft SQL Server administration, including performance tuning, backup/recovery, high availability, security, and production troubleshooting. 
  • Experience administering PostgreSQL and/or MySQL in production environments. 
  • Experience operating databases in AWS, especially RDS, Aurora, and EC2-hosted database platforms. 
  • Strong understanding of database monitoring, alerting, capacity planning, backup strategy, disaster recovery, patching, and operational support practices. 
  • Proven ability to diagnose and resolve production database issues, including performance degradation, blocking, failed jobs, replication issues, storage constraints, and application-related database problems. 
  • Experience working with engineering teams to improve database design, indexing strategies, query performance, and application data access patterns. 
  • Experience with database migration projects, ideally including SQL Server to PostgreSQL or movement from self-managed databases to AWS-managed database services. 
  • Ability to develop scripts, automation, reports, or operational tooling to improve database administration and monitoring. 
  • Familiarity with DocumentDB, OpenSearch, data lakes, or broader cloud data platforms is a plus, but not required. 
  • Strong analytical, communication, and documentation skills. 
  • Demonstrated ability to operate calmly and effectively in production incident situations. 
  • A bachelor's degree required for candidate consideration. MS in Computer Science, Engineering, or related field is a plus.
